Why most online businesses are doomed from the outset

It's sad, but even today the vast majority of online businesses still manage to fail before they actually begin…

‘Why?’ you might well ask.

Because 98 per cent of the people trying to do business online, don't know how to go about choosing a niche.

In fact, most of them make one of two huge mistakes:

Mistake #1 - Targeting a market that is too broad (i.e. Trying to compete with Amazon.com by selling books or other common household items online)

Mistake #2 - Targeting a niche that is overly saturated(i.e. Trying to get a foothold in the ‘Internet Marketing’ or ‘How To Make Money Online’ niche)

What users want to find when they search online

This little table says it all…

Top 5 e-commerce niche purchasing categories

a) Computers (4.3 million buyers);
b) Electronics (7.4 million buyers);
c) Software (9.6 million buyers);
d) CDs/Videos/DVDs (11.2 million buyers);
e) Digitised Books and Information (17.5 million buyers).

Information products outstrip all other e-commerce niche purchasing options and this opens the door to you in the development of your retirement money-maker plan. This table incidentally is extracted from a Forrester Survey (the internet research arm) on online buying patterns for the year 2004.
